Pop / Rock 03 December, 2009

Universal Music Publishing Group Signs Exclusive World-wide Publishing Agreement With Adam Young Of Owl City 'Fireflies' Hits No 1 On Billboard Hot 100

New York, NY (Top40 Charts/ UMPG) - Universal Music Publishing Group (UMPG) today announced the signing of an exclusive world-wide publishing agreement with No. 1 songwriter/artist Adam Young of Owl City. The publishing deal encompasses all of the Owl City catalogue, including Adam's major label debut Ocean Eyes. "We couldn't be happier to be working with David Renzer, Tom Sturges, Evan Lamberg and the entire UMPG team," said Steve Bursky, management of Owl City. "Their creativity and forward thinking ideas will make them great partners for Adam and Owl City."

"I am so honored to be a part of the Universal Music Publishing Group family," added Adam Young.

Owl City's hit song "Fireflies" is currently the best selling track in U.S. and Canada, reaching No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100. The song was also No. 1 on the iTunes Singles Chart. The single has sold over 1.3 million to date.

Owl City's first official CD - Ocean Eyes (Universal Republic) - was released in July of this year and is Top 10 on the Billboard Top 200; No. 2 on the Top Dance/Electronica Albums chart; and Top 20 on the Billboard Top Digital. Ocean Eyes has sold nearly over 180,000 copies since its release. Owl City is currently featured on the 90210 soundtrack with the song "Sunburn."

Adam Young released his first, self released digital release Of June on MySpace in June 2007. Recorded in his parent's basement, word of mouth began to spread for Adam's music. Maybe I'm Dreaming, released digitally in March of 2008, was Owl City's full-length debut. Adam became a phenomenon on MySpace and currently has more than 11 million profile views and 52 million plays - outstanding for such a short span of time.

The publishing deal encompasses all of the Owl City catalogue, including the four singles off of Ocean Eyes, "Fireflies," "Hello Seattle," "Strawberry Avalanche," and "Hot Air Balloon."

Managed by Steve Bursky and Brian Winton of Foundations Artist Management, Owl City will continue Adam's sold out tour of North America this Fall before heading to China and Japan.
